Why read it?

1 author picked Murder at an Irish Bakery as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

Every time a new Irish Village Mystery by Carlene O’Connor comes out, I’m first in line at the bookstore.

I love Garda Siobhan O’Sullivan and her siblings, whom she fondly refers to as the O’Sullivan Six. In this book, the ninth in the series, I was delighted to revisit the village of Kilbane in County Cork as Siobhan and her swoon-worthy husband, Garda Macdera Flannery, follow the clues to catch a murderer who took out one of the contestants of a televised baking show.

The humor in this series always leaves me laughing out loud and ready for another visit…
